March E-Newsletter
"Don't just count your years, make your years count" - George Meredith, novelist and poet
I celebrated a
birthday this week. Not a big decade-changer, just an oddball number quietly
acknowledged over cake. I must be growing up because as a child, my
birthday was all about the number and the gifts (often books). Today, the gifts aren’t as
important to me as spending time with the people I care about – but thanks to a program we just launched, they can make a big difference for others.
This year, I’m pledging my birthday to the
Charlotte Mecklenburg Library Foundation.
In a nutshell, I’m asking my friends and family to make a gift to the Library
Foundation in lieu of a gift for me – it’s that simple, and I still get the cake! I hope you’ll consider pledging your birthday too.
Your Library is also growing. You may have heard reports of a reimagined Main Library as a cornerstone of Uptown's Sixth and Tryon Vision Plan. Your Library has always been about so much more than books, and we are thrilled to build on over one hundred years of service as we adapt to meet the needs of the next century. It's a turning point for the Library and our community, and we look forward to celebrating many more milestones together.
Thank you, as always, for your support.
